user's latest post:
making my PNG transparent
Published (2009-11-29 17:37:00)
StarStock wrote: You need to use "merge layers" or "merge visible" to maintain the transparency. Not if you use "save for web." But you do need to turn off the visibility of any layer (including solid backgrounds) that you don't want to show. So all your layers can be unmerged, but it needs to look like you want it to and you need to see the gray checkerboard where you want the design...

user's latest post:
Calender Setting does not work
Published (2009-11-30 14:49:00)
Here's a work around that might be suitable. Select the choice to show no date grid at all. Create your own grids with a graphics program inserting whatever you'd like for holidays and upload them as an image. That's what I did for my calendar just to get custom historical dates related to my theme.
